Common malfunctions

Healthcare facilities in Seattle face unique challenges due to constant use, specialized infrastructure, and the city’s damp climate. HVAC systems must run continuously, making them prone to wear and inefficiency. Plumbing issues, such as leaks or outdated pipes, can compromise sanitation. Electrical networks may become overloaded by modern medical equipment. Water infiltration caused by heavy rainfall can damage structural elements, while worn flooring in high-traffic areas poses safety risks for patients and staff.

  • Frequent HVAC malfunctions due to heavy demand.
  • Leaks or water damage from Seattle’s rainy climate.
  • Outdated plumbing reducing efficiency and sanitation.
  • Electrical systems struggling with modern equipment loads.
  • Worn floors in patient rooms, hallways, and lobbies.

These malfunctions reduce operational efficiency and can impact patient care, making timely repair and reconstruction essential.

Reasons for reconstruction Seattle Healthcare Facility Construction

There are several reasons why healthcare facility reconstruction is crucial in Seattle. First, compliance with modern safety, fire, and accessibility standards requires updating older buildings. Second, the growing demand for healthcare services means expanding or remodeling facilities to serve more patients. Third, energy efficiency improvements reduce operational costs in a city known for its sustainability goals. Finally, updating design and functionality enhances patient comfort, staff efficiency, and overall quality of care.

  • Meeting healthcare codes and patient safety standards.
  • Expanding capacity to accommodate Seattle’s growing population.
  • Improving energy efficiency and sustainability.
  • Modernizing outdated facilities to support advanced equipment.
  • Increasing property value and competitiveness in healthcare markets.

These reasons demonstrate why healthcare facility construction is not just about repair but about future-proofing Seattle’s medical infrastructure.

How is Seattle Healthcare Facility Construction repair carried out

The process of healthcare facility construction and remodeling in Seattle is highly regulated and requires precision. Pioneer Remodel begins with a detailed assessment of existing structures, focusing on compliance with healthcare standards. Planning includes architectural design, securing permits, and ensuring ADA accessibility. During reconstruction, old infrastructure such as plumbing, HVAC, or electrical systems may be replaced to meet modern requirements.

Construction includes building or reinforcing foundations, framing, and installing specialized medical infrastructure such as ventilation systems, sterile rooms, and reinforced flooring. Energy-efficient windows, insulation, and eco-friendly materials are often used to align with Seattle’s sustainability policies. Interiors are designed to improve patient comfort and staff workflow, incorporating durable finishes, noise control, and flexible layouts. The final stage includes inspections to ensure compliance with healthcare and city regulations, guaranteeing safe and efficient operations.

Cost of Seattle Healthcare Facility Construction repair

The cost of healthcare facility construction in Seattle varies widely depending on the size, specialization, and complexity of the project. Large hospitals with advanced equipment demand higher investments than small neighborhood clinics. Material choice, sustainability features, and design complexity also impact cost. Remodeling older facilities may require additional expenses for structural upgrades or hazardous material removal. Compliance with Seattle’s regulations and healthcare standards adds further requirements that affect the budget.

  • Project size: clinic, specialized center, or hospital.
  • Material and finish selection for durability and hygiene.
  • Specialized infrastructure for medical equipment.
  • Upgrades to meet ADA and safety standards.
  • Permits, inspections, and compliance costs in Seattle.

Prevention and maintenance

Regular maintenance is essential to extend the life of healthcare facilities in Seattle and to maintain high standards of patient care. HVAC, plumbing, and electrical systems should be inspected frequently due to constant demand. Waterproofing and drainage solutions help protect against Seattle’s heavy rainfall. Floors, walls, and finishes require regular upkeep to ensure hygiene and durability. Preventive maintenance reduces downtime, increases efficiency, and ensures compliance with healthcare regulations.

  • Schedule frequent inspections of HVAC, plumbing, and electrical systems.
  • Maintain waterproofing to prevent leaks and mold.
  • Replace worn flooring in high-traffic zones regularly.
  • Clean and sanitize surfaces to meet healthcare standards.
  • Ensure accessibility features remain functional and up to code.
